1. The Skin Microbiome: Your Invisible Army of Health
Whatโs the Deal with Bacteria on Your Face?
For years, dermatologists preached the gospel of โcleanse thoroughly,โ but now weโre learning that our skinโs microbiomeโa bustling ecosystem of trillions of microorganismsโis critical for barrier function, immune protection, and even mood regulation.
- Key Findings:
- A 2023 study inย Natureย revealed that imbalances in the skin microbiome (e.g.,ย Cutibacterium acnes) correlate with conditions like acne, rosacea, and psoriasis.
- Probiotic skincare (thinkย Streptococcus thermophilus-infused serums) can restore microbial diversity and reduce inflammation.
- How to Apply This Science:
- Avoid over-washing with harsh surfactants like SLS. Opt for gentle, prebiotic cleansers.
- Incorporate topical probiotics or fermented foods (kefir, kimchi) into your diet to support gut-skin axis health.

3. Personalized Skincare: Beyond Buzzwords
While โpersonalizationโ has been marketed as a trend, true science-based customization relies on data-driven insights:
- The Power of DNA Testing:
- Companies likeย GlossGeneticsย analyze your genome to predict skin sensitivities, UV damage risk, and ideal moisturizer pH.
- Example: A person with aย COL1A1ย variant may benefit from retinol earlier in life to prevent collagen breakdown.
- AI Skin Mapping:
- Tools likeย Proven Skincareย use AI to analyze your skinโs texture, pigmentation, and dehydration levels in minutes.
- Result: Customized product formulas tailored to your unique needs.
4. Regenerative Medicine: Grow Your Own Skin
From stem cells to 3D-printed tissues, regenerative tech is repairing skin injuries and reversing signs of aging:
- Stem Cell Therapies:
- Fat-derived stem cells are used to regenerate damaged skin in burn victims and those with chronic wounds.
- Cosmetic applications include injectables that boost elastin and hyaluronic acid production.
- 3D Bio-Printing:
- Researchers at Wake Forest University have created lab-grown skin grafts for patients with severe burns.
- Future iterations could print pigment cells to treat vitiligo.
5. Pollution-Proof Skin: Your New Enemy is Invisible
Urban dwellers are exposed to 10x more particulate matter than rural residents, and this isnโt just bad for your lungsโit accelerates skin aging:
- The Science of Pollution-Induced Aging:
- Particles penetrate the skin, triggering inflammation and free radical damage.
- A 2022ย Journal of Investigative Dermatologyย study found that pollution exposure increases wrinkle depth by 20%.
- How to Protect Yourself:
- Layer antioxidants and niacinamide to neutralize free radicals.
- Look for โpollution-shieldingโ formulas with ingredients like chlorella or activated charcoal.
